From 15d20a03d6e1c995fa8b80542568f5db4091f734 Mon Sep 17 00:00:00 2001 From: Rob Landley Date: Mon, 29 May 2006 05:00:44 +0000 Subject: [PATCH] Remove _() and N_() from platform.h. #define them as NOP macros in the two files still using them. I didn't remove them from e2fsck.c to avoid stomping pending cleanup patches from Garrett, and I didn't bother to remove them from fdisk.c because that entire file needs to be rewritten from scratch. --- e2fsprogs/e2fsck.c | 3 +++ include/platform.h | 16 ++++------------ util-linux/fdisk.c | 2 ++ 3 files changed, 9 insertions(+), 12 deletions(-) diff --git a/e2fsprogs/e2fsck.c b/e2fsprogs/e2fsck.c index 6f3fd7eda..ceafaea4b 100644 --- a/e2fsprogs/e2fsck.c +++ b/e2fsprogs/e2fsck.c @@ -39,6 +39,9 @@ #include "e2fsck.h" /*Put all of our defines here to clean things up*/ +#define _(x) x +#define N_(x) x + /* * Procedure declarations */ diff --git a/include/platform.h b/include/platform.h index b77d815f8..d684c2dda 100644 --- a/include/platform.h +++ b/include/platform.h @@ -97,18 +97,16 @@ #endif /* ---- Endian Detection ------------------------------------ */ -#if !defined __APPLE__ && !(defined __digital__ && defined __unix__) -# include -# include -#endif #if (defined __digital__ && defined __unix__) # include # define __BIG_ENDIAN__ (BYTE_ORDER == BIG_ENDIAN) # define __BYTE_ORDER BYTE_ORDER +#elif !defined __APPLE__ +# include +# include #endif - #ifdef __BIG_ENDIAN__ # define BB_BIG_ENDIAN 1 # define BB_LITTLE_ENDIAN 0 @@ -188,13 +186,7 @@ typedef unsigned long long int uintmax_t; #define PRIu32 "u" #endif - -/* NLS stuff */ -/* THIS SHOULD BE CLEANED OUT OF THE TREE ENTIRELY */ -#define _(Text) Text -#define N_(Text) (Text) - -/* THIS SHOULD BE CLEANED OUT OF THE TREE ENTIRELY */ +// Need to implement fdprintf for platforms that haven't got dprintf. #define fdprintf dprintf /* THIS SHOULD BE CLEANED OUT OF THE TREE ENTIRELY */ diff --git a/util-linux/fdisk.c b/util-linux/fdisk.c index 8ceeb4835..26ec2e363 100644 --- a/util-linux/fdisk.c +++ b/util-linux/fdisk.c @@ -10,6 +10,8 @@ #define UTIL_LINUX_VERSION "2.12" +#define _(x) x + #define PROC_PARTITIONS "/proc/partitions" #include